Handover: Exportron retry queue

Hi Mira — handing over the failed-export retries. Exports that hit a timeout land in the retry queue and get three attempts with backoff; after that they're parked and need a manual requeue from the admin panel. Watch for customers reporting duplicates — that usually means a double requeue. The current retry settings are as follows.

settings of bajog-fawig:
oliael:
  log_level: warn
  metrics_host: metrics.oliael.zemvarsys.internal
  pin: 0267
  pool_size: 32

### Renderer tuning

The Quillpress markdown pipeline parses, sanitizes, and renders in three bounded stages. Each stage enforces limits to prevent pathological documents — deeply nested blockquotes, enormous tables — from starving the worker pool. Future maintainers should note that these limits were derived empirically from the Fenwick corpus, not chosen arbitrarily. Raising any of them requires re-running the fuzz suite. The current limits are defined here.

constants for tageg-kagag:
QUOTAS = {
    "kelax": 495,
    "istath": 366,
    "tammir": 108,
    "novdor": 730,
    "casax": 816,
    "quenael": 874,
    "pelius": 403,
}

### Step 7: Enable SQL linting

All SQL files under `db/` in the Quillbrook repo are now checked by our linter before merge. The old migration tooling tolerated inconsistent casing and missing semicolons; the new pipeline does not. Run the linter locally before pushing, since CI will reject violations rather than warn. Most fixes are automatic with the `--fix` flag, but manual review is required for reserved-word renames. The rules the pipeline enforces come from this configuration.

service settings:
[norax]
team = zormir
access_code = ac_c302d9
owner = ralmir.zorox
host = norax.zarqeltech.internal
port = 11211
peer = praion.halixlabs.example
salt = 9c2a54f3
pin = 9824